Qlds007 replied to the topic Bit of advice needed for newie in the forum Yes a considerable 17 years, 3 months ago
Yes a considerable difference.A Commercial loan cannot be mortgage insured so means you would be limited at best to an 80% LVR.In todays climate this is more likely to be back to somewhere around 65-70%.As Terry has indicated it may well be that depending on the size of the apartment you will again be limited to a similar LVR as you would with a…[Read more]

Qlds007 replied to the topic purchasing property overseas in the forum Overseas Deals 17 years, 3 months ago
No Australian lender wil take overseas property as security. If you lived in Vietnam you maybe able to get a loan with Anz Vietnam.Nothing to stop you taking out a line of credit on your Australian security and using the funds to buy overseas. Fraut with problems but doable.

Qlds007 replied to the topic Help – Should i buy a second investment in the forum Help Needed! 17 years, 3 months ago
Just be careful as many lenders require that all Adult beneficiaries (THATS right beneficiaries) Guarantee the loan.Your mortgage broker should be able to recomend lenders that have less onerous requirements and costs when it comes to Trust structures.

Qlds007 replied to the topic investment loan vs home loan in the forum Finance 17 years, 3 months ago
Hans Yes buying an invesment property first does not preclude you from qualifying for the FHOG down the track when you come to buy your own PPOR assuming all other conditions of the Grant are met.Of course if you go to Contract on your PPOR after 1 July 2009 then the Grant could be back to $7000.
